国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 開發 > PHP > 正文

php中計算時間差的幾種方法

2024-05-04 21:51:13
字體:
來源:轉載
供稿:網友

在php中計算時間差有時候是件麻煩的事!不過只要你掌握了日期時間函數的用法那這些也就變的簡單了:

一個簡單的例子就是計算借書的天數,這需要php根據每天的日期進行計算,下面就來談談實現這種日期計算的幾種方法:

(1) 如果有數據庫就很容易了!若是MSSQL可以使用觸發器!用專門計算日期差的函數datediff()便可!若是MYSQL那就用兩個日期字段的差值計算的計算結果保存在另一個數值型字段中!用時調用便可!

(2)如果沒有數據庫,那就得完全用php的時間日期函數!下面主要說明之:

例:計算1998年5月3日到1999-6-5的天數:

<? $startdate=mktime("0","0","0","5","3","1998");
$enddate=mktime("0","0","0","6","5","1999");

//所得到的值為從1970-1-1到參數時間的總秒數:是整數.那么

//下面的代碼就好編多了:
$days=round(($enddate-$startdate)/3600/24) ;

//days為得到的天數;
若mktime()中的參數缺省,那表示使用當前日期,這樣便可計算從借書日期至今的天數.

請作者聯系本站,及時附注您的姓名。聯系郵箱:CuoXIn#vip.qq.com(把#改為@)。

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 满洲里市| 金秀| 灌阳县| 贡山| 三河市| 龙州县| 蚌埠市| 宁都县| 永吉县| 涞源县| 拉孜县| 拜泉县| 甘泉县| 建阳市| 遵义县| 洛南县| 乐清市| 岚皋县| 工布江达县| 凤凰县| 南阳市| 凤台县| 台东市| 合水县| 张掖市| 玛沁县| 长宁县| 南昌县| 台北县| 思南县| 辛集市| 泌阳县| 秦安县| 滦平县| 叙永县| 大荔县| 吴川市| 武功县| 怀化市| 大丰市| 卓尼县|